Description
This unit of competency specifies the outcomes required to supervise the removal process for friable and non-friable asbestos containing material (ACM). The unit includes planning for and supervising the removal process, including preparing the work area and the work site, using safe and compliant removal practices, maintaining safety procedures, and supervising the decontamination and removal processes. Ensuring compliance with the asbestos removal control plan (ARCP) is central to the effective performance of the role. This includes ensuring and documenting that required air monitoring and other testing and certification processes are conducted by licensed asbestos assessors according to legislation.

Elements and Performance Criteria
1 Plan for asbestos removal.
- 1.1 Work instructions, other required information and the client’s brief are obtained, clarified, confirmed and applied for planning purposes.
- 1.2 Asbestos register, if available, is obtained and reviewed to inform planning.
- 1.3 Work site is inspected to confirm requirements and inform the planning process.
- 1.4 Scope of job is identified and initial preparations are conducted according to workplace requirements.
- 1.5 Staffing levels required for completion of job are confirmed.
- 1.6 Required quantity of materials is calculated according to job specifications and quality requirements.
- 1.7 Safety requirements and data from asbestos register, project construction safety emergency plan, safe work methods statement (SWMS) for a construction site, and other information sources are identified to prepare for a safe and compliant removal process.
- 1.8 Plant, tools, equipment and personal protective equipment (PPE) to carry out the job are identified, sourced and steps taken to ensure their serviceability.
- 1.9 Environmental requirements are identified for the job according to environmental plans and regulatory obligations, including preparations for a clearance inspection by a licensed asbestos assessor.
- 1.10 Processes required to meet health-monitoring and air-monitoring requirements are identified and planned with the licensed asbestos assessor and within limits of own responsibility.
- 1.11 Occupants, neighbours and other affected parties are notified according to legislation and the code of practice and within limits of own responsibility.
- 1.12 Proper identification and handling of asbestos containing materials are planned and implemented according to legislative and regulatory requirements.
- 1.13 ARCP is developed within limits of own responsibility.
- 1.14 Required documentation is prepared and steps are taken toensure authorisationaccording to legislative and company requirements.
- 1.15 Arrangements and work schedules are organised so that compliant supervision of the asbestos removal job is undertaken.
2 Prepare site for removal.
- 2.1 Workers’ certificates of competency for the type of removal required are sighted by the supervisor and records are kept on site.
- 2.2 Team members are provided with instructions for the safe and compliant conduct of the job according to the ARCP.
- 2.3 Steps are taken to ensure the signage and barricades to delineate the work area from the work site are erected according to legislative requirements.
- 2.4 Notification documents for the job, copy of asbestos removal licence, and training documents are secured and steps taken to retain them on site.
- 2.5 Daily air-monitoring readings are posted on the work site according to legislative requirements.
- 2.6 Team members are provided with PPE and its proper usage and fit are checked.
- 2.7 Steps are taken to ensure all equipment is installed and checked for serviceability according to legislation and manufacturer specifications for use.
- 2.8 Final safety checks are made of the site, including ensuring that utilities are deactivated and secured prior to commencing work.
3 Supervise testing, compliance and documentation in consultation with the licensed asbestos assessor and the asbestos removalist.
- 3.1 Communication is undertaken with the licensed asbestos assessor to ensure compliance with legislative requirements for air monitoring.
- 3.2 Testing of equipment and work site is supervised to ensure compliance with legislative requirements.
- 3.3 In consultation with the licensed asbestos assessor and the asbestos removalist ensure that corrective action is taken, as required, should initial test results not conform to legislative requirements.
- 3.4 On advice from the licensed asbestos assessor, steps are put in place to ensure removal does not occur until air-monitoring checks have been undertaken and documented according to legislative requirements.
- 3.5 Required documentation is completed and forwarded to authorities according to legislative and workplace requirements.
4 Oversee removal and decontamination processes.
- 4.1 Set-up and daily checking of equipment are supervised to ensure safety, efficiency and compliance with legislative requirements.
- 4.2 Removal of asbestos from the structure is supervised using safe work methods and according to the ARCP, regulatory requirements and codes of practice.
- 4.3 Steps are taken to ensure asbestos is contained and placed in double-lined bins or ‘double-bagged’ according to regulatory requirements.
- 4.4 Bags are sealed, labelled and removed from work area to designated work site area according to the ARCP.
- 4.5 Arrangements are made with removal firms and bin suppliers to ensure the timely and appropriate removal of ACM from the site, and waste facility dumping receipts are received as evidence of compliance.
- 4.6 Supervision is provided of the facilities and processes to ensure the compliant decontamination of team members and the work area and work site.
- 4.7 Clearance inspection, including air monitoring as required, is conducted of work area, work site and equipment to ensure job is completed according to legislative and workplace requirements.
- 4.8 Site is secured according to legislative requirements until clearance inspection and air-monitoring results have been approved and clearance certificate has been received.
- 4.9 Incidents are identified and reported according to company and legislative requirements.
5 Supervise and support team members.
- 5.1 Appropriate training on site is provided to asbestos removal team workers to ensure safe and compliant operations of the job site, including use of the ARCP, company’s WHS policies, and site safety plan.
- 5.2 Work is scheduled to ensure the timely and efficient completion of the job and operation of the team.
- 5.3 Processes are put in place to encourage open communication with team members regarding safety and the appropriateness of work practices.
- 5.4 Constructive feedback is provided to team members regarding work performance to improve efficiency and safe work practices.
- 5.5 Steps are taken to build and reinforce a workplace culture that supports quality, compliant operations and safety.
- 5.6 Team performance is managed according to company and legislative requirements.

Information to ensure the safe and correct completion of the job may include:
assessor’s control air-monitoring report
company policies and procedures
JSA and SWMS for construction as required
operating manuals (WHS management systems) and specifications for materials and equipment
asbestos register
diagrams or sketches
instructions issued by authorised organisational or external personnel
manufacturer specifications and instructions, where specified and SDS
regulatory and legislative requirements for enclosing and removing friable and non-friable asbestos
relevant Australian standards and codes
safe work procedures relating to enclosing and removing asbestos
signage
memos, verbal and written instructions, and diagrams
work bulletins, work schedules, plans and specifications.
Preparations at the commencement of the jobmay include:
preparing and implementing the ARCP
assessing conditions and hazards
determining work requirements, and safety plans and policies
consulting with local authorities (councils) and local waste management and transport authorities to determine requirements
identifying equipment defects
identifying and preparing for containing and removing asbestos from a work site according to ARCP
inspecting work site
conducting work site inductions.
Materials must be relevant to the type of asbestos removed and may include:
acrylic paint to seal ACM
approved and branded or labelled plastic bags
duct tape
foam infill spray
gaffer tape
plastic sheeting
polyvinyl alcohol (PVA) adhesive as spray / spray tack glue
rags or other material wipes
heavy-duty polythene bags (200 μm minimum thickness)
200 μm unused (not recycled) plastic sheeting or drop sheet
drums or bins in good condition with well-fitting lids and labelled with required warning sign
signs
timber frames, nails, aluminium poles and other materials required for enclosures.
Quality requirements may include:
internal company quality policy and standards
manufacturer specifications
relevant regulations, including Australian standards
workplace operations and procedures.
Safety procedures are to be according to state and territory legislation and regulations and project safety plan and may relate to:
conduct of work site induction
emergency procedures, including extinguishing fires, and evacuation
handling activities that may require the assistance of others or the use of manual or mechanical lifting devices where size, weight or other issues, such as a disability, are a factor
hazard control
hazardous materials and substances
organisational first aid requirements
PPE prescribed under legislation, regulations and workplace policies and practices
safe operating procedures according to SWMS, including the conduct of operational risk assessment and treatments associated with:
deactivating or securing utilities, including electrical, air conditioning and water services
earth leakage boxes
falling objects
lighting
plant movement
power cables, including overhead service trays, cables and conduits
restricted access barriers
surrounding structures
traffic control
trip hazards
work site visitors and the public
working at heights
working in confined spaces
working in proximity to others
use of firefighting equipment
use of tools and equipment
workplace environmental requirements and safety.
Plant, tools and equipment must be relevant to the job (whether for the removal of friable or non-friable ACM), may require separate licensing for use, and may include:
high efficiency particulate air (HEPA) vacuum cleaners to comply with AS3544-1988 and AS4260-1997 as amended from time to time
pipelines
anchorage points for enclosures
atomiser water bottles and hand pressure sprayer
barricades
barricade tape, including para-webbing or fencing
bars (crow and pinch)
bolt cutters
buckets
cold chisels
enclosure equipment for large-scale asbestos removal work
excavators
mini-enclosures for small-scale asbestos removal work
glove bag or wrap and cut equipment
negative air pressure enclosures or bubbles
negative pressure exhaust units
PVA adhesive as spray / spray tack glue
scaffolds
scrapers
shovels and spades
signs
smoke generators
staple guns
decontamination unit and remote decontamination units if required for large-scale removal
decontamination facilities for non-friable asbestos removal
drills (manual and low-speed only)
enclosures for large-scale asbestos removal work
flame retardant polythene
hammers
hand drills
hardboard / corex
hoses and spray fittings
ladders to comply with construction regulations.
Personal protective equipment will be specified to the requirements of the job and may include:
protective clothing, such as:
disposable coveralls with fitted hood and cuffs
safety footwear (pull-on, not lace-up)
disposable or protective gloves
determining the respiratory protection class appropriate to the type of asbestos to be removed, which may be P1, P2 or P3, or using full-face, powered, air purifying particulate respirator fitted with class P3 filter cartridge
correct face fitting and use of respiratory protective equipment
spare sets of PPE
general WHS requirements, including first aid kit locations.
Environmental requirements must fully reflect legislation and the Code of Practice for the Safe Removal of Asbestos, including:
clean-up management
dust and noise management
sedimentation control
vibration management
waste management, including the safe disposal of ACMs, including waste water from decontamination unit (DCU).
Asbestos containing materials (both friable and non-friable) may include:
Note:
Non-friable asbestos is also known as bonded asbestos
ACM notionally listed as non-friable may become friable due to weathering or damage
acoustic plaster soundproofing
adhesives and glues
asbestos cement
asbestos cement moulded guttering
asbestos cement sheets
asbestos tiles
bitumastic felts and materials
cable bandages
compressed asbestos cement panels
floor vinyl covering
gaskets
millboard
mortar
pipe lagging
electrical meter boxes and related devices
woven textiles, ropes, tapes and braids
decorative coatings
resinous backing board
sealant mastic
sprayed on fireproofing, soundproofing and thermal insulation
tape
thermal insulation.
Compliant supervision entails being:
on site at all time for the removal of friable asbestos
accessible for the removal of non-friable asbestos.
Work site may include:
residential, commercial, industrial and public buildings
plant, equipment and fire boards (e.g. friction plant and gaskets)
demolition sites
fences
soil
ships and other forms of transport.
Utilities may include:
air conditioning
electricity
water services.
Testing procedures:
must:
conform to legislative requirements
be conducted by a licensed asbestos assessor
may include:
air monitoring
analysis of materials to determine presence and type of ACM
smoke tests for leaks in the enclosure.
Documentation may include:
air-monitoring results
asbestos register
notification of asbestos removal work to the regulator as required
asbestos removal control plan
WHS management system
JSA and SWMS for construction
implementation and development of emergency plan
health-monitoring program
leak test results
clearance inspections and certificates
training certificates.
Safe work methods may include:
compliant set-up of the asbestos work area, including set-up of negative air, lighting, water and emergency supplies
placing adequate signage around work site
fire and emergency system requirements
enclosure of the asbestos removal area and the plant, equipment and fixtures remaining in the area
testing of the asbestos work area by a licensed asbestos assessor
procedures for entering and leaving the asbestos work area
safe techniques for removing friable and non-friable asbestos
packaging, sealing and removing contaminated plant, tools and equipment
cleaning and decontaminating the asbestos work area
decontaminating and demobilising the work site
final decontamination of personnel
disposing of asbestos waste.
Appropriate training for team members may include:
conducting on-site training, either one-on-one or small group sessions
recording the mandatory unit of competency for workers for licensed asbestos removal work
providing briefings and explaining the content of induction manuals.
